Behind the scenes of OFP's community play

Last week, OFP members began gathering for hands-on set and prop-making sessions to prepare for our upcoming community theatre showcase at Eastside Arts Alliance. The group includes ¡Si Se Puede! cast members, our volunteer stage crew, their friends, families, and neighbors--all learning, creating, and collaborating to transform blank canvases into physical expressions of their shared vision.

Yoli, one of OFP's base members and a trained artist, shared her thoughts with our lead organizer after the first painting session:

"Good evening Flavio. I arrived home safely and happy to be with you all for a common cause. That's what gives meaning to existence: having purposes, contributing even a little to doing something for someone, because we deserve a change for the better, for the health and good vibes of the UNIVERSE."

— Yoli

Yoli led the group in learning painting technique--mixing colors, making precise brushstrokes, and creating dimension and shadow to bring the sets to life. Her message to Flavio underlined the mission of OFP's Teatro project: cultivating spaces to bring folks together and build leadership from within our communities to creatively and collectively realize our visions of change.
